Subject: Flagline cut-over complete

Quick summary for the sync: Flagline, our feature-flag rollout framework, is now the sole flag source for all tenant services. Legacy Togglebarn evaluators are in read-only mode and shut off Friday. No incidents during cut-over; one stale flag was purged. Dashboards updated. The production evaluator fleet is running with the configuration values below.

service settings:
PRAIX_LOG_LEVEL=error
PRAIX_METRICS_HOST=metrics.praix.qorvelcorp.corp
PRAIX_POOL_SIZE=16

**Ticket #: Bike cage & parking gates — Merrow Court**

Reported: bike cage reader intermittently rejecting valid badges; both parking gates slow to cycle. Vendor visit booked Thursday morning. Until resolved, assistants should advise riders to use the keypad entry on the cage and direct drivers to the north gate only. Manual release handles are for security staff, not tenants. Keypad entry requires the interim code below.

staff pass of yafof-baweg = bdg-OLNEG-5

# Lanternbay Environments: Per-Tenant Rate Quotas

Each Lanternbay environment (dev, staging, prod) enforces its own per-tenant rate quotas, and they are intentionally not identical. Staging quotas are set lower to surface throttling bugs early, while prod quotas reflect contractual tiers. As a contractor, never copy quota blocks between environments without sign-off from the platform lead. For reference during onboarding, the staging environment currently runs with the following quota configuration.

settings of fafog-haduf:
ZORIX_PIN=4648
ZORIX_METRICS_HOST=metrics.zorix.paliqsys.corp
ZORIX_LOG_LEVEL=info
ZORIX_TENANT=druix

Vendor update: our license for Fabrikell, the test-data factory library from Quillmark Systems, renews next month. We've audited usage across the Larkspur and Pinefold services and confirmed only the core module is exercised, so we'll downgrade to the base tier. Quillmark has agreed to backport the seeded-randomness fix we requested. For renewal questions or to flag additional usage, reach their account lead directly.

alerts address for bawif-hahig: norwyn_gorys_lamath@olvarqlabs.test